"use client";
const require_create_event_handler = require("../../core/utils/create-event-handler/create-event-handler.cjs");
let react = require("react");
let _mantine_hooks = require("@mantine/hooks");
//#region packages/@mantine/core/src/utils/Floating/use-context-menu-handlers.ts
function useContextMenuHandlers({ childProps, disabled, opened, longPressDelay = 500, setReference, open }) {
const touchActiveRef = (0, react.useRef)(false);
const gestureHandledRef = (0, react.useRef)(false);
const touchTargetRef = (0, react.useRef)(null);
const disabledRef = (0, react.useRef)(disabled);
disabledRef.current = disabled;
const openAtPoint = (clientX, clientY, contextElement) => {
setReference({
getBoundingClientRect: () => ({
x: clientX,
y: clientY,
width: 0,
height: 0,
top: clientY,
left: clientX,
right: clientX,
bottom: clientY,
toJSON: () => void 0
}),
contextElement
});
open();
};
const onMouseDown = require_create_event_handler.createEventHandler(childProps.onMouseDown, (event) => {
if (disabled) return;
if (event.button === 2) event.stopPropagation();
});
const onContextMenu = require_create_event_handler.createEventHandler(childProps.onContextMenu, (event) => {
if (disabled || event.defaultPrevented) return;
event.preventDefault();
if (gestureHandledRef.current) return;
openAtPoint(event.clientX, event.clientY, event.currentTarget);
if (touchActiveRef.current) gestureHandledRef.current = true;
});
const longPressHandlers = (0, _mantine_hooks.useLongPress)((event) => {
if (disabledRef.current || gestureHandledRef.current) return;
const touchEvent = event;
const touch = touchEvent.touches[0] ?? touchEvent.changedTouches[0];
if (!touch) return;
openAtPoint(touch.clientX, touch.clientY, touchTargetRef.current);
gestureHandledRef.current = true;
}, {
threshold: longPressDelay,
events: ["touch"],
cancelOnMove: true,
onStart: (event) => {
touchActiveRef.current = true;
gestureHandledRef.current = false;
touchTargetRef.current = event.currentTarget;
},
onFinish: (event) => {
touchActiveRef.current = false;
gestureHandledRef.current = false;
if (!disabledRef.current) event.preventDefault();
},
onCancel: () => {
touchActiveRef.current = false;
gestureHandledRef.current = false;
}
});
return {
onContextMenu,
onMouseDown,
onTouchStart: require_create_event_handler.createEventHandler(childProps.onTouchStart, longPressHandlers.onTouchStart),
onTouchEnd: require_create_event_handler.createEventHandler(childProps.onTouchEnd, longPressHandlers.onTouchEnd),
onTouchCancel: require_create_event_handler.createEventHandler(childProps.onTouchCancel, longPressHandlers.onTouchCancel),
onTouchMove: require_create_event_handler.createEventHandler(childProps.onTouchMove, longPressHandlers.onTouchMove),
style: disabled ? childProps.style : {
...childProps.style,
WebkitTouchCallout: "none",
WebkitUserSelect: "none",
userSelect: "none"
},
"data-expanded": opened ? true : void 0
};
}
//#endregion
exports.useContextMenuHandlers = useContextMenuHandlers;
